Andrea Cheng (September 19, 1957 – December 26, 2015)[1][2] was a Hungarian-American author of children's books and poet, best known for her Anna Wang Series of middle grade novels and Shanghai Messenger.
[2] She was raised in Cincinnati, Ohio, as the child of Hungarian immigrant parents who originally came from Australia and emigrated in 1954.
[4] After she returned from Switzerland, she studied at Cornell University to receive her master's degree in Linguistics.
[4] In addition to writing books, she taught English as a Second Language as well as Children's Literature at Cincinnati State Technical and Community College.
[4] Cheng died of breast cancer on December 26, 2015, at the age of 58, after a long illness.
